The clean label movement has been on the increase and is predicted to keep doing so as customers become more conscious of the advantages clean labels have for their health … WebFSIS protects the public's health by ensuring that meat, poultry and egg products are safe, wholesome and properly labeled. FSIS is part of a science-based national system to ensure food safety and food defense. FSIS ensures food safety through the authorities of the Federal Meat Inspection Act, the Poultry Products Inspection Act, and the Egg ...

WebMar 22, 2024 · This is an important difference to be aware of, particularly when applying food management procedures to your premises. Food safety refers to an entire system of managing risks. Meanwhile, food hygiene refers to an individual set of practices for controlling only one aspect. A flood, fire, national disaster, or the loss of power from high winds, snow, or ice could jeopardize the safety of your food. Knowing how to determine if food is safe and how to keep food safe will help minimize the loss of food and reduce the risk of foodborne illness.
